Non-IT SMEs often stay away from public clouds because they cannot quantify the financial gain of using these new technologies. The PAChA project has two goals:
- To develop a new type of private cloud appliance (portable, inexpensive, self-managing and secure) and monitor the resources used by various applications running on it.
- To develop tools to estimate the potential savings (based on a pricing model) when deploying applications on our private cloud, public or hybrid cloud.
